Failed RAM, CTC or SIO Test
Error Type:
Fatal
Possible Cause:
1. Memory Conflict.
2. Temporary network problem.
3. Bad memory address selected.
4. The parameters selected for Channel Setup may be incorrect.
5. Card Corrupted.
Solution:
1. Some other device may be using the same memory address. Configure the device with a different memory
address.
2. Restart the driver.
3. The memory address selected is not within the range: try a different memory address.
4. Modify the Channel Properties with appropriate values.
5. Replace the card.
Failed to enable card for Device '<device name>'
Error Type:
Fatal
Possible Cause:
1. A network failure occurred.
2. A memory conflict occurred.
3. The Channel Properties may have been set inaccurately.
4. The card is corrupted.
Solution:
1. Check for any broken links between the card and the host. Make sure that the card is inserted properly on the
appropriate slot and then restart the driver.
2. Assign a different memory base address.
3. Modify the Channel Properties with appropriate values.
4. Replace the card.
Failed to perform M16 Key Write for device '<device name>'
Error Type:
Fatal
Possible Cause:
1. The jumper settings on the KTXD card may be in 8 bit mode.
2. The ISA bus slot may be corrupted.
3. The card memory may be corrupted.
Solution:
1. Change it to 16-bit mode. Refer to KTXD user's guide for more information.
2. Try a different ISA slot.
3. Replace the card.
